Analyze Star Ratings

In what ways can star ratings help homeowners choose a painting contractor? Star ratings provide a fast visual snapshot of a contractor's general standing. A higher rating usually signals reliable quality and customer satisfaction, making it a key factor for homeowners to consider. Nevertheless, it is important to consider the volume of reviews in addition to the star rating; a contractor who holds a high rating supported by limited reviews may not present a trustworthy measure. In contrast, a lower rating derived from a large number of reviews may point to recurring concerns. Homeowners should also look for patterns in ratings, such as frequent mentions of professionalism or timeliness. Through a thoughtful review of these ratings, homeowners can make educated choices and enhance the probability of selecting a qualified painting contractor.

In-Depth Project Estimates

How can clients make certain they obtain a comprehensive grasp of the painting project's scope and cost? By posing targeted questions throughout the estimation process, clients can resolve all details of the project. Important inquiries ought to address the breakdown of labor and material costs, the projected timeframe for finishing the work, and any supplementary charges that might occur. Clients should also seek specifics concerning the categories of paints and finishes planned for use, as well as prep work that will be necessary. It's critical to be aware of the payment arrangement, including upfront deposits and final balances. By maintaining clarity in these matters, clients can avoid surprises and secure a detailed project estimate that aligns with their expectations and budget.

Coverage and Guarantees

Grasping the financial elements of a painting project is essential, but clients must also evaluate the safeguards presented by insurance and warranties. When choosing a painting contractor, it is essential to confirm that they carry liability insurance. This shields homeowners against potential damages or accidents that may happen throughout the project. Additionally, clients should inquire about workers' compensation insurance to safeguard against injuries experienced by workers during the project.

Guarantees also hold significant importance; homeowners should question the duration and coverage of labor as well as materials. A reliable contractor should offer a warranty that guarantees the standard of craftsmanship and materials applied. By addressing these key questions, clients can facilitate a more efficient and confident paint project outcome.

How to Understand Pricing and Obtain Written Estimates

Steering through the intricacies of pricing and obtaining written estimates can considerably affect the overall experience of hiring a paint contractor. To gain a clear understanding of costs, homeowners should request detailed estimates from multiple contractors. A comprehensive estimate should outline materials, labor, and any extra charges, eliminating the possibility of surprise costs down the line.

It is important to evaluate these quotes not only regarding price but also in the details of the work described. Clients should inquire about the grade of materials selected and the contractor's level of expertise, as these elements can impact the overall outcome.

Additionally, acquiring a written estimate works as a binding agreement, safeguarding both the homeowner and the professional. This agreement should include timelines, payment plans, and service guarantees. By prioritizing openness and honesty, customers can decide with confidence and choose a professional that suits their needs and financial plan.
